This application is with Wiltshire for determination, against a statutory target of eight weeks. Over the last year Wiltshire decided heritage and listed building applications in a median of 57 days. More in our guide to how long planning decisions take.
About heritage and listed building applications
Listed building consent is needed for works that affect the special interest of a listed building, and carrying out such works without it is a criminal offence. More in our guide to planning application types.
